PNC Bank is the banking division of The PNC Financial Services Group, a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ania-based company which acquired BBVA, the Houston, Texas-based US division of Spain's Banco Bilbao Vizcaya Argentaria, for $11.6 billion in June 2021. BBVA accounts were transitioned to PNC Bank by October of that year.

With the acquisition, PNC became the 5th largest bank in the United States with $560 billion in assets.

In addition to operating former BBVA branches in the Birmingham District, PNC Bank maintains a heavy technology presence at its Birmingham Technology Center. The bank also operates technology centers in Pittsburgh and Cleveland, Ohio. Local operations are overseen by Nick Willis, president of PNC's Northern and Central Alabama division since 2017.
